I got a NULL pointer dereference report when doing fault injection test:
BUG: kernel NULL pointer dereference, address: 0000000000000009 ... RIP: 0010:static_call_del_module+0x7a/0x100 ... Call Trace: static_call_module_notify+0x1e1/0x200 notifier_call_chain_robust+0x6f/0xe0 blocking_notifier_call_chain_robust+0x4e/0x70 load_module+0x21f7/0x2b60 __do_sys_finit_module+0xb0/0xf0 ? __do_sys_finit_module+0xb0/0xf0 __x64_sys_finit_module+0x1a/0x20 do_syscall_64+0x34/0xb0 entry_SYSCALL_64_after_hwframe+0x44/0xae
When loading a module, if it fails to allocate memory for static calls, it will delete the non-existent mods (mods == 1) in the static_call_module_notify()'s error path.
static_call_module_notify static_call_add_module __static_call_init site_mod = kzalloc() // fault injection static_call_del_module // access non-existent mods
This patch fixes the bug by skipping the operation when the key has no mods.
Fixes: a945c8345ec0 ("static_call: Allow early init") Signed-off-by: Wang Hai <wanghai38@huawei.com> --- kernel/static_call.c | 2 +- 1 file changed, 1 insertion(+), 1 deletion(-)
diff --git a/kernel/static_call.c b/kernel/static_call.c index 43ba0b1e0edb..c3f8ffc5a52f 100644 --- a/kernel/static_call.c +++ b/kernel/static_call.c @@ -400,7 +400,7 @@ static void static_call_del_module(struct module *mod) for (site = start; site < stop; site++) { key = static_call_key(site); - if (key == prev_key) + if (key == prev_key || !static_call_key_has_mods(key)) continue; prev_key = key; -- 2.17.1
